Rudy Gobert Fined $75,000 for Money Gesture in Playoff Game
NBA penalizes Timberwolves center for insinuating referees' bias during Game 4 against the Nuggets.
- Gobert directed the gesture at officials after being called for a foul in the fourth quarter.
- This is Gobert's second fine for the same gesture this season, previously fined $100,000 in March.
- The NBA cited Gobert's history of inappropriate conduct toward game officials in its decision.
- Timberwolves head coach Chris Finch criticized the fine, calling for transparency in NBA penalties.
- The series between the Timberwolves and Nuggets is tied 2-2, with Game 5 approaching.
